Persuasive Essay Writing Tips

In persuasive or convincing essays, a writer tries to convince about the argument and wants his reader to believe it. To make it effective what the writer has to do is first make an outlining of an argument, then find facts about his arguments which strongly support the argument and should involve those facts which the reader will easily accept. Therefore they should be logical and relative. The following section will help an essayist to write more efficiently.

Unbiased Facts

While writing an essay a writer tries to give support to his argument through facts and examples, while doing this he should be careful that his facts should be:

  • Logical
  • Realistic
  • Unbiased
  • Relative
  • To the point

And here it is important to note that any imprecise fact will damage your foundation and you will lose your impression.

Be Specific

While living in the 21st century it is better to admit that no one has time to read irrelevant stuff. So, all you have to do is be specific with your argument. Only a few readers will appreciate broad generalization, for maximum effect be specific with your facts as well with your writing. It will leave a positive impact on the reader’s mind because they will get their answers within specific words.

Medley of Evidences

To strongly capture your reader’s mind try to be versatile with your evidences. They could be

  • Examples from the same scenario you are describing
  • Quotes from experts
  • Statistical Data

While writing it might be possible some times that the evidence you are describing is not helping. So you should not take risks with one or two evidences. Try to utilize all the factors which can support your argument, in other words to create magic sometimes you need to show all tricks.

Defeat the opposing arguments

When the reader reads a persuasive essay his mind is dragged into an ocean of questions and he tries to defeat the writer’s idea. But an essayist should first try to create a quizzing effect so that readers should start thinking about the argument and then he should provide the reader with all the answers his mind might be struggling to find out.
